Posted: Wed Feb 13, 2008 9:26 pm    Post subject: Big Blacks want Meat !  

I've baited for over 23 years now and have found all the big bears we have killed came off of meat baits.Baits that were tended daily with fresh beef and horse scraps.

Black Bear must vary greatly by region.
Early in our season ( Fall only in Minnesota ) meat does not attract many bear. Later it works well. Even locally success with meat is hit or miss. Meat always attracts crows, lots of crows.

Meat and meat based baits have always worked well for the spring (May-early June) however our fall season ( August-September) grains sweet stuff usually work much better.

Most bait stands around here are in alder thickets with very heavy canopy's not much chance of birds even seeing it.

The bears I have shot (fall bears) have always had a sweet tooth as well. Donuts and molasses seemed to work best for me but smoked fish works well initially to get the bears to my set then I switch to the sweets to keep them there. After the sweets are out they don't seem to want to touch the smoked fish which I usually end up taking out because the coons get in it.
